[0001] This utility model relates to elevator components, and more particularly to an anti-loosening elevator guide rail bracket. Background Technology
[0002] An elevator is a vertical lifting machine powered by an electric motor, used to transport passengers or goods up and down in multi-story buildings, and has the advantage of being convenient.
[0003] Elevators typically consist of a car, guide rails, and supports. The car moves up and down along the guide rails, which are fixed in the shaft by the supports. To facilitate adjustment, the supports usually have oblong holes. However, during the elevator's movement, the supports can easily shift internally, causing changes in the relative position of the guide rails and the shaft, which in turn leads to a decrease in the elevator's lifting performance. In addition, the supports usually include two support plates with different structures, which increases the complexity of their production and installation. Utility Model Content
[0004] Purpose of the utility model: The purpose of this utility model is to provide an anti-loosening elevator guide rail bracket, which is not prone to internal displacement, has good anti-loosening performance, and is easy to manufacture and install.
[0005] Technical solution: An anti-loosening elevator guide rail bracket includes: The first and second support plates, which have the same structure, both include a plate body and a first oblong hole and a second oblong hole respectively provided on two sides of the plate body; The fastening assembly includes a bolt, a first nut, a locking sleeve, and a second nut, all threaded onto the bolt's shank. One end of the locking sleeve is threaded into the first nut, and the other end of the locking sleeve abuts against the second nut. The bolt's shank passes through a first oblong hole in the first support plate and a first oblong hole in the second support plate. The head of the bolt abuts against the body of the second support plate, and the first nut abuts against the body of the first support plate.
[0006] Optionally, the fastening assembly further includes: An internal thread is provided inside the first nut; An external thread is provided on one end of the anti-loosening sleeve; The internal thread and the external thread are mated.
[0007] Optionally, the fastening assembly further includes a gasket located between the head of the bolt and the body of the second support plate.
[0008] Optionally, the type of gasket is a flat gasket or a spring gasket.
[0009] Optionally, both the first support plate and the second support plate further include reinforcing ribs, which are connected to both sides of the plate body.
[0010] Optionally, the number of the first waist-shaped holes and the number of the second waist-shaped holes are both two, one end of the reinforcing rib is located between the two first waist-shaped holes, and the other end of the reinforcing rib is located between the two second waist-shaped holes.
[0011] Optionally, both the first support plate and the second support plate may further include a reinforcing plate connected to the plate body.
[0012] Optionally, the connection between the reinforcing plate and the plate body is a bending connection.
[0013] Beneficial effects: (1) Since the first support plate and the second support plate have the same structure, only one type of support plate needs to be produced during production. During installation, only two support plates need to be used, which makes the production and installation less complicated. (2) The first nut is used to lock the plate body of the first support plate and the plate body of the second support plate. The anti-loosening cylinder is used to prevent loosening and further lock the plate body of the first support plate and the plate body of the second support plate. The second nut further locks the plate body of the first support plate and the plate body of the second support plate, so that the internal displacement of the anti-loosening elevator guide rail bracket of this scheme is not easy to occur, thereby preventing the relative position of the guide rail and the shaft from changing, and thus preventing the lifting performance of the elevator from deteriorating. [0017] Example 1 like Figures 1-2This embodiment provides an anti-loosening elevator guide rail bracket, including: a first support plate 1 and a second support plate 2 with identical structures, each including a plate body 33 and a first oblong hole 31 and a second oblong hole 32 respectively provided on both sides of the plate body 33; a fastening assembly 4, including a bolt 44 and a first nut 41, an anti-loosening sleeve 43 and a second nut 42, all threadedly sleeved on the screw 442 of the bolt 44. One end of the anti-loosening sleeve 43 is threadedly sleeved in the first nut 41, and the other end of the anti-loosening sleeve 43 abuts against the second nut 42. The screw 442 of the bolt 44 passes through the first oblong hole 31 of the first support plate 1 and the first oblong hole 31 of the second support plate 2. The head 441 of the bolt 44 abuts against the plate body 33 of the second support plate 2. The first nut 41 abuts against the plate body 33 of the first support plate 1.
[0018] Specifically, the plate body 33 of the first support plate 1 and the plate body 33 of the second support plate 2 are detachably connected through the first oblong hole 31 and the fastening assembly 4. The first oblong hole 31 facilitates the adjustment of the relative horizontal position of the first support plate 1 and the second support plate 2. The plate body 33 of the first support plate 1 is also used to connect with the shaft through the second oblong hole 32 and the expansion bolt 44, etc. The plate body 33 of the second support plate 2 is also used to connect with the guide rail through the second oblong hole 32 and the bolt assembly, etc. The second oblong hole 32 facilitates the adjustment of the relative vertical position of the first support plate 1 and the shaft, and also facilitates the adjustment of the relative vertical position of the second support plate 2 and the guide rail. Since the first support plate 1 and the second support plate 2 have the same structure, in production... During production, only one type of support plate needs to be manufactured. During installation, only two support plates need to be used, which simplifies the production and installation process. The first nut 41 is used to lock the plate body 33 of the first support plate 1 and the plate body 33 of the second support plate 2. The anti-loosening cylinder 43 is used to prevent loosening and further lock the plate body 33 of the first support plate 1 and the plate body 33 of the second support plate 2. The second nut 42 further locks the plate body 33 of the first support plate 1 and the plate body 33 of the second support plate 2. This makes it easier for the internal displacement of the anti-loosening elevator guide rail bracket of this solution to be prevented, thereby preventing changes in the relative position of the guide rail and the shaft, and thus preventing a deterioration in the lifting performance of the elevator.
[0019] Furthermore, such as Figure 1 , Figures 3-4 The fastening assembly 4 further includes: an internal thread 411 located within the first nut 41; and an external thread 431 located outside one end of the anti-loosening sleeve 43; wherein the internal thread 411 and the external thread 431 are engaged. Specifically, the engagement of the internal thread 411 and the external thread 431 facilitates a threaded connection between one end of the anti-loosening sleeve 43 and the first nut 41.
[0020] Furthermore, such as Figure 1The fastening assembly 4 also includes a washer 45 located between the head 441 of the bolt 44 and the plate body 33 of the second support plate 2. Specifically, the washer 45 is used to increase the anti-loosening performance of the plate body 33 of the first support plate 1 and the plate body 33 of the second support plate 2.
[0021] Furthermore, such as Figure 1 The type of gasket 45 is either a flat gasket or a spring gasket. Specifically, flat gaskets facilitate the easy installation of gasket 45; spring gaskets facilitate the anti-loosening performance of gasket 45.
[0022] Furthermore, such as Figures 1-2 Both the first support plate 1 and the second support plate 2 also include reinforcing ribs 5, which are connected to both sides of the plate body 33. Specifically, the reinforcing ribs 5 are used to increase the strength of the first support plate 1 and the second support plate 2 and prevent deformation of the first support plate 1 and the second support plate 2.
[0023] Furthermore, such as Figure 2 The number of first oblong holes 31 and second oblong holes 32 are both two. One end of the reinforcing rib 5 is located between the two first oblong holes 31, and the other end of the reinforcing rib 5 is located between the two second oblong holes 32. Specifically, the two first oblong holes 31 and the two second oblong holes 32 facilitate the installation stability of the first support plate 1 and the second support plate 2.
[0024] Furthermore, such as Figures 1-2 Both the first support plate 1 and the second support plate 2 also include a reinforcing plate 6 connected to the plate body 33. Specifically, the reinforcing plate 6 is used to further increase the strength of the first support plate 1 and the second support plate 2 and prevent the first support plate 1 and the second support plate 2 from deforming.
[0025] Furthermore, such as Figures 1-2 The connection between the reinforcing plate 6 and the plate body 33 is a bending connection. Specifically, the bending connection facilitates the good integrity of the first support plate 1 and the second support plate 2.
